About Anna V. Davis

Anna V. Davis is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Materials Chemistry, Biomaterials, Physical and Theoretical Chemistry and Inorganic Chemistry, having authored 15 papers that have together received 1.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Supramolecular Chemistry and Complexes (8 papers), Supramolecular Self-Assembly in Materials (4 papers), Crystallography and molecular interactions (4 papers), Magnetism in coordination complexes (3 papers), Organometallic Complex Synthesis and Catalysis (2 papers), Metal-Organic Frameworks: Synthesis and Applications (2 papers), Trace Elements in Health (2 papers) and Metal complexes synthesis and properties (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Inorganic Chemistry (455 citations), Organic Chemistry (796 citations), Physical and Theoretical Chemistry (248 citations), Spectroscopy (416 citations) and Biomaterials (214 citations). Anna V. Davis has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Germany and France. Frequent co-authors include Kenneth N. Raymond, Thomas V. O’Halloran, Robert M. Yeh, Marco Ziegler, Darren W. Johnson, Dorothea Fiedler, Andreas Terpin, Yi Xue, Gurusamy Balakrishnan and Thomas G. Spiro.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Nature Chemical Biology, Chemistry - A European Journal, Angewandte Chemie International Edition and Inorganic Chemistry.
